Corporate records.
(1) A corporation shall keep as permanent records minutes of all meetings of
the corporations shareholders and board of directors, a record of all actions
that the shareholders or board of directors takes without a meeting and a
record of all actions that a committee of the board of directors takes in place
of the board of directors on behalf of the corporation.
(2) A corporation
shall maintain appropriate accounting records.
(3) A corporation
or the corporations agent shall maintain a record of the corporations
shareholders, in a form that permits preparation of a list of the names and
addresses of all shareholders in alphabetical order by class of shares showing
the number and class of shares each shareholder holds.
(4) A corporation
shall maintain the corporations records as documents capable of conversion
into a tangible written form within a reasonable time.
(5) A corporation
shall keep a copy of the following records at the corporations principal
office or registered office:
(a) The articles
or restated articles of incorporation and all amendments to the articles of
incorporation or restated articles of incorporation that are currently in
effect;
(b) The
corporations bylaws or restated bylaws and all amendments to the bylaws or
restated bylaws that are currently in effect;
(c) Resolutions
that the corporations board of directors adopts to create one or more classes
or series of shares and fixing the relative rights, preferences and limitations
for each class or series, if shares issued pursuant to those resolutions are
outstanding;
(d) The minutes
of all shareholders meetings and records of all action that shareholders take
without a meeting, for the past three years;
(e) All written
communications to shareholders generally within the past three years;
(f) A list of the
names and business addresses of the corporations current directors and
officers; and
(g) The
corporations most recent annual report delivered to the Secretary of State
under ORS 60.787. [1987 c.52 §169; 2017 c.55 §16]
